Understanding Your Wi-Fi Network
Before we dive into the nitty-gritty of monitoring your Wi-Fi usage, it’s essential to understand the basics of your network. Your Wi-Fi network is a collection of devices connected to a central hub, usually a router. The router assigns IP addresses to each device, allowing them to communicate with each other and access the internet.

Method 1: Check Your Router’s Web Interface
Most routers have a web interface that allows you to monitor connected devices, view network traffic, and adjust settings. To access your router’s web interface:
- Open a web browser and type the router’s IP address (usually 192.168.0.1 or 192.168.1.1).
- Log in with your admin username and password (usually printed on the underside of the router or in the user manual).
- Look for the “Attached Devices” or “Connected Devices” section, which displays a list of devices connected to your network.

Interpreting the Data
Once you’ve gathered data about the devices connected to your Wi-Fi network, it’s essential to interpret the information correctly. Here are some tips:
- Identify unknown devices: If you notice devices connected to your network that you don’t recognize, it may indicate unauthorized access. Change your Wi-Fi password and consider implementing additional security measures.
- Monitor bandwidth usage: If you notice devices consuming excessive bandwidth, it may impact your network’s performance. Consider adjusting your network settings or upgrading your internet plan.
- Optimize your network: Use the data to optimize your network’s performance. Adjust your router’s settings, switch to a different channel, or upgrade your router to improve your network’s speed and reliability.
Securing Your Wi-Fi Network
Monitoring your Wi-Fi usage is just the first step. Securing your network is crucial to prevent unauthorized access and protect your data. Here are some tips:
- Use a strong password: Choose a unique and complex password for your Wi-Fi network.
- Enable WPA2 encryption: WPA2 is the latest encryption standard for Wi-Fi networks. Ensure it’s enabled on your router.
- Set up a guest network: Create a separate network for guests to prevent them from accessing your main network.
- Regularly update your router’s firmware: Keep your router’s firmware up-to-date to ensure you have the latest security patches.

What is the difference between a device’s IP address and its MAC address?
A device’s IP address is a unique numerical address that is assigned to it by the router. The IP address is used to identify the device on the network and to route data packets to it. The IP address is usually in the format of four numbers separated by dots (e.g., 192.168.1.100). On the other hand, a device’s MAC address is a unique hardware address that is assigned to its network interface card (NIC). The MAC address is used to identify the device at the data link layer of the network and is usually in the format of six pairs of hexadecimal numbers separated by colons (e.g., 00:11:22:33:44:55).
While the IP address can change over time, the MAC address remains the same and is unique to the device. This makes the MAC address a more reliable way to identify devices on a network. In addition, the MAC address can be used to filter out unwanted devices from the network or to set up a MAC address-based access control list (ACL) to restrict access to certain devices.
How can I identify unknown devices on my Wi-Fi network?
To identify unknown devices on your Wi-Fi network, you can use a combination of methods. First, you can check the device’s IP address and MAC address to see if they match any known devices on your network. You can also check the device’s name and manufacturer to see if it matches any known devices. If the device is still unknown, you can try to connect to it using a web browser or a network scanning app to see if it has a web interface or any open ports.
Another way to identify unknown devices is to check their network activity patterns. You can use a network monitoring tool to track the device’s network activity and see if it matches any known patterns. For example, if the device is constantly sending data to a specific IP address, it may indicate that it is a malicious device. By analyzing the device’s network activity patterns, you can gain more insight into its identity and purpose.
What are some common signs of unauthorized Wi-Fi network usage?
There are several common signs of unauthorized Wi-Fi network usage. One sign is a sudden increase in data consumption or a spike in network activity. Another sign is the presence of unknown devices on the network, which can be detected using a network scanning app or by checking the router’s web interface. You may also notice that your internet connection is slow or unstable, which can be caused by unauthorized devices consuming bandwidth.
Additionally, you may notice that your router’s lights are flashing more frequently than usual, which can indicate that there is a high volume of network activity. You may also receive notifications from your internet service provider (ISP) about unusual network activity or data consumption. If you notice any of these signs, it is essential to investigate further to determine the cause and take corrective action to secure your network.
How can I secure my Wi-Fi network from unauthorized access?
To secure your Wi-Fi network from unauthorized access, you can take several steps. First, you should change the default administrator password and network name (SSID) to prevent unauthorized access to your router. You should also enable WPA2 encryption and set up a strong password to prevent unauthorized devices from connecting to your network.
Additionally, you can set up a guest network to isolate visitors from your main network. You can also enable MAC address filtering to restrict access to specific devices. Furthermore, you can set up a firewall to block incoming and outgoing traffic to and from your network. Regularly updating your router’s firmware and monitoring your network activity can also help to detect and prevent unauthorized access.
